简书 java二级,Java(二)

981f9d7936e2

Java 数据类型

变量

定义格式 :数据类型 变量名 = 变量值;

java 是强类型语言,对于每一种数据都定义了明确的具体数据类型,在内存中分配了不同大小的内存空间。

数据类型

Java 中数据类型的分类分为:基本数据类型 和 引用数据类型;

基本数据类型分类(4 类 8 种)

整数型

byte 占一个字节 -128 到127;

short 占 两个字节 -2^15~2^15-1;

int占四个字节 -2^31~ 2^31-1;

long占 八个字节 -2^63~ 2^63-1;

浮点型

float 占四个字节 -3.503E38~3.403E38 单精度;

double 占八个字节 -1.798E308~1.798E308 双精度;

字符型

char 占两个字节,即 16位, 0 ~65535 (没有负数);

字符型字⾯值是⽤单引号引起来的,并且单引号⾥⾯只能有⼀个字符,可以是汉字。

布尔型

Boolean 理论上是占 八分之一字节,因为一个开关可以决定 true 和 false 但是 Java中Boolean 类型 没有明确指定他的大小;

示例

byte a = 10;

short s = 20;

int i = 30; 整数默认的数据类型就是 int 类型

long x = 40; 如果long 类型 后面 加 L 进行标识,最好加 大L ,因为 l 太 像 1 了

float f = 12.3F; float 出现小数, 必须加 F 或者 f

double d = 33.4; 小数默认的数据类型是 double

char c = 'a';

boolean  b = true;

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值